The Corrib: Myth, Legend & Folklore

This exhibition features specially-commissioned artwork by Sadie Cramer, which explores some of the old myths and stories about the lake, river and bay and sets them in a broader context. Lough Corrib, the largest lake in the Republic, is connected to Galway Bay by a short and powerful river. 

This temporary exhibition is one of the highlights of Galway City Museum’s 2020/21 exhibition programme.  It will run in the museum foyer until 28 September 2021.
